I'm often confronted with my self-absorbed ways when in a social situation. I'm not inconsiderate, but I am wrapped up in my own feelings and issues, blind to how others are feeling and their issues. It's a very unattractive quality and I've been trying to curb it. I haven't been very successful. It gives a poor first impression, and also strains whatever relations I have managed to build.

Has anyone else come to acknowledge their self-absorbed ways, and found a way to change them?

I have a game I play while with the humans. I try to stay as quiet as possible. Since I tend to talk WAY too much I end up talking about the right amount. Since I started this game it seems to be working. I might have even made friends with one of the humans in the office where I work by accident.

Since it is a game I play by my rules for me it is fun. AND the humans seem to like me better as well. I will never BE a human, but at least being around them is more comfortable. And as you know, comfort is SO important!
